In an interesting turn of events, a recent confrontation in the world of Counter-Strike has set the gaming community abuzz. The team known as ‘KOI’ has made a striking return to the arena, while their adversaries, ‘Never More’, have been disqualified over allegations of cheating.

The Cheating Controversy

User Arnaton laments, ‘It’s a shame how many cheaters are in a Major Qualifier.’ (source) This sentiment echoes the frustration of many, who believe such incidents deflate the worthiness of the qualifiers and hinder fair competition. The disqualification has left some users questioning the efficiency of the current anti-cheat measures in place.

Comparisons with League of Legends

JustLuck101, another user, highlights a perceived disparity between Counter-Strike and other games: ‘Crazy how League of Legends is getting a better anti cheat then…. CS2’ (source). This suggests that players are looking towards Valve for more stringent anti-cheat mechanisms.
